Ryanair forced to change course in how it sells insurance online

Ryanair has made changes to how it sells insurance on its website following intervention by the National Consumer Agency.

In September, following an investigation, the consumer rights body told the airline of its concerns relating to the manner in which it was selling insurance on its website.

The NCA felt Ryanair presented information in relation to the sale of travel insurance in a manner which was “unclear, ambiguous and could cause some consumers to unwittingly purchase a policy”.
